What to Confirm Before Booking in Broadview

Use these checks when comparing exterminators serving Broadview. They are designed to make each estimate more specific, easier to verify, and less dependent on generic averages.

  • Verify that termite inspections and wood-destroying insect reports are priced separately.
  • Request the product label or treatment category when allergies, children, or pets are a concern.
  • Separate general pest service from termite, bed bug, mosquito, and wildlife work.
  • Confirm re-treatment windows, interior access requirements, and pet re-entry instructions.
  • Ask for the estimate, warranty, exclusions, and scheduling assumptions in writing.

Estimate itemWhy it mattersQuestion to ask
Follow-up policyA cheap first visit can be poor value if retreatment or monitoring is excluded.How many visits are included, and what triggers a no-charge callback?
Interior accessPets, children, allergies, and tenant access can change preparation and timing.What prep steps, product category, and re-entry window apply?
Exterior conditionsMoisture, mulch, vegetation, gaps, and entry points affect whether treatment holds.Which exterior conditions should the homeowner correct before or after service?
Warranty limitsSome warranties exclude sanitation issues, structural entry points, or heavy infestations.What conditions would void the service guarantee?

When to Call Now vs. Plan Ahead in Broadview

Call sooner when you see

  • Repeated sightings after a recent treatment window has already passed.
  • Active stinging insects near an entry, walkway, deck, or play area.
  • Suspected bed bugs, termites, or wood-destroying insects.

Plan ahead for

  • Seasonal exterior barrier service before peak activity.
  • Exclusion work after entry points have been identified.
  • Inspection before a sale, lease turnover, or long vacancy.

DIY Pest Prevention in Broadview

Reduce pest problems in your Broadview home with these prevention strategies:

  • Seal entry points – Inspect foundations and weather stripping, especially important given Illinois's seasonal pest invasions during spring and fall transitions.
  • Reduce moisture – Fix leaks promptly; ants and other pests are attracted to water sources.
  • Store food properly – Use sealed containers to avoid attracting spiders and rodents.
  • Maintain your yard – Trim vegetation away from your home to reduce pest harborage areas.
  • Schedule regular inspections – Given Illinois's moderate termite risk, annual inspections are wise.
